The Bayview is home to the city\u2019s highest population of Black residents, but also has significant immigrant populations.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Many issues on this year\u2019s ballot are highly relevant to the Bayview community, especially the Black community, including affirmative action, affordable housing and rent control, voting rights for parolees, and the police budget.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>The Efforts<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Across a wide range of fields, organizers say the solution to driving voter turnout is education. Various grassroots organizations are holding community voter registration drives, creating voter guides, and even helping residents mail in their ballots.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>One active community organization is Mother Brown\u2019s, a program under the United Council of Human Services (UCHS) that feeds people in the community, providing three meals a day, transitional housing, case management, and more to people experiencing homelessness.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cI&#8217;m a political science major, so I knew how important it was for people to vote,\u201d said the director of the UCHS, Gwendolyn Westbrook. \u201cEvery day when I first started, I would go downstairs to where the dining room was, and explain to people that they had to vote; the only way we were ever gonna get any place was if they voted.\u201d&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Westbrook helped hundreds who came through the doors of Mother Brown\u2019s register each year and mail their ballots. Arieann Harrison, who works at Mother Brown\u2019s, would explain ballot measures and difficult words to those with questions.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>With COVID-19 restrictions, Mother Brown\u2019s now offers takeout only, but Westbrook said she has more clients than ever, and her efforts to get them to vote haven\u2019t stopped. Early this month her step-daughter Kescha Mason, with Delta Sigma Theta sorority\u2019s alumnae chapter, co-led a voter registration drive out front of UCHS, debunking myths about voting and sending a voter awareness car caravan through District 10.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>The Issues&nbsp;<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Westbrook believes people are tired enough to vote. \u201cIt\u2019s not just Trump, I think it&#8217;s a whole gamut of issues that people are now starting to become very aware of,\u201d Westbrook said. Having just been released from federal prison himself in September, Washington is also a supporter of Prop 17, which will restore voting rights to parolees.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cBlack people as a whole, with the mass incarceration in America, we&#8217;ve been disenfranchised. So just that being able to get your voting rights back, that&#8217;s huge,\u201d Washington said.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>However, Prop 17 is only a step in the right direction. \u201cThere&#8217;s a lot of obstacles in the way of people who are getting out of prison to make a smooth and successful transition back into society.\u201d Washington is living in a Tenderloin halfway house, unable to find a place to live with his fianc\u00e9e.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The SF Bay View has a designated section for prisoners\u2019 stories, which is where Washington got involved with the paper several years ago. Meanwhile Brown hosts a radio show advocating for prisoners and a monthly event called \u201cLiberate the Caged Voices.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cDisenfranchisement, that\u2019s just straight civil death,\u201d Brown said. She believes all disenfranchisement is a form of exploitation: prisoners are counted as residents of where they are imprisoned, not their home communities. This causes underrepresentation in their true home, and through artificially inflated numbers, gives political power to more rural white communities where prisoners are often held.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Washington and Brown are getting to know their new community, and trying to raise awareness at the same time. \u201cSince I&#8217;ve been out, I hit the ground running, like sprinting,\u201d Washington said.&nbsp;<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>With countless issues on the table, residents of the Bayview neighborhood are organizing and educating those in their community to get more people to the polls (or mailboxes) this election, hoping for change this time around.&nbsp; Historically, parts of the Bayview have had lower voter turnout compared to other areas of San Francisco.
